Bahar Boteh Pendant
The boteh, the Persian paisley born from the cypress, is one of the oldest motifs of Persian art, a sign of life and renewal. I have drawn a single boteh in pavé brilliant-cut white diamonds on 18ct white gold, its centre left open and polished, with a soft-pink morganite resting in the curl.
Quiet, modern, and unmistakably Persian, it hangs from a fine white-gold chain. From Bahar, my spring collection. Designed in London and crafted in Birmingham's Jewellery Quarter.
Materials: 18ct white gold; white diamonds (pavé outline); morganite accent; fine white-gold chain. UK hallmarked.
